Artist: Robert Ralph
For Robert Ralph, art is far more than skill and technique—it is a way to communicate thoughts, memories, emotions, and ideas. Every painting tells a story, and every brushstroke serves a purpose in capturing the essence of a subject and inviting viewers to see the world through a different lens. Through his work, Robert hopes to inspire others to slow down, appreciate the beauty that surrounds them, and embrace the precious gift of life.
Drawing inspiration from simple, often overlooked places, Robert believes that beauty is not reserved for the grand and spectacular. Instead, he finds meaning and wonder in everyday scenes that many might pass by without a second glance. His artwork encourages viewers to rediscover the extraordinary within the ordinary and to appreciate life’s quiet moments.
Although Robert discovered a love for creativity at a young age, he did not begin his artistic journey in earnest until the age of 55. After a career in welding, he traded his torch for paintbrushes, pencils, and charcoal, embarking on a new chapter of artistic exploration. A pivotal influence in this transition was his wife, Alexis, whose encouragement and unwavering belief in his potential inspired him to step outside his comfort zone and pursue his passion for art.
Whether serious or whimsical, realistic or imaginative, Robert’s work reflects a heartfelt appreciation for life, faith, and the beauty found in everyday experiences. His art serves as both an invitation and a reminder to pause, reflect, and find joy in the world around us.
